Latest Patents

One of Hess's latest patents is a quaternization process that focuses on the purification of glycidyl (meth)acrylate. This process involves a two-stage distillation method. In the first stage, the glycidyl (meth)acrylate is distilled in the presence of a solvent, such as water, which forms a low boiling point heteroazeotrope with light impurities and epichlorohydrin. This results in a head fraction that consists primarily of a solvent-light products heteroazeotrope. In the second stage, the purified glycidyl (meth)acrylate is distilled again, this time using a second solvent that forms a low boiling point azeotrope with glycidyl (meth)acrylate. This method effectively separates the required pure glycidyl (meth)acrylate from heavy impurities.
